| using internal::SymmetricTensorAccessors::StorageType< 4, dim, Number >::base_tensor_type = Tensor<2, n_rank2_components, Number> |
Declare the type in which we actually store the data. Symmetric rank-4 tensors are mappings between symmetric rank-2 tensors, so we can represent the data as a matrix if we represent the rank-2 tensors as vectors.
